Despite being added at the last minute, Brock Lesnar emerged as the new WWE champion at Day 1, seemingly throwing plans for the Royal Rumble and WrestleMania up in the air. Host Adam Silverstein and co-host Chris Vannini open the show with a discussion about WWE's releases coming back to bite it in the ass before moving into The Main Event [18:30] as they look at Lesnar's title win, his new No. 1 contender as decided on Raw and what's ahead for former champion Big E. The guys then break down the rest of Raw in The Good, The Bad and The Ugly [36:30], including Becky Lynch's lack of title challengers, AJ Styles being squashed by Omas, the Edge and Beth Phoenix match being scheduled for Royal Rumble, Damian Priest's gimmick and more. "The Silver King" and "Vintage" wrap things up by opening the mailbag to answer listener questions [1:09:30] about how recent booking decisions may alter plans for the Royal Rumble and WrestleMania.
